A goal from Mohamed Elneny and two (2) goals from Eddie Nketiah in the second half helped the Gunners to secure a victory.
Manchester City will welcome Arsenal FC in the next round of the competition on January 28, 2023, at Etihad Stadium.

Arsenal has played one FA Cup game against Manchester City since Mikel Arteta was appointed as the club manager and never lost to the Citizens.
Two (2) goals from former Arsenal FC captain, Pierre Emerick Aubameyang were enough to help Mikel Arteta’s side earn the victory over Manchester City in the FA Cup semifinal game on July 18, 2020.
Then the club proceeded to defeat Chelsea FC in the final to lift the cup for the fourteenth time, the most by a club in the history of the competition.
The last time Oxford United played Arsenal FC in the FA Cup Third round, the Gunners won by 2-0 goals and went ahead to win the trophy in the 2002-2003 season.
